Hemp and Flax Greek Yogurt Overnight Oats

Creamy rolled oats mixed with protein-rich Greek yogurt, ground flaxseed, and hemp seeds. A quick, prep-ahead breakfast tailored for high protein without added sugar or high-oxalate chia seeds.

  1. 01

    Add 0

    In a medium glass jar or storage container, add 0.5 cup rolled oats, 1 tbsp ground flaxseed, and 1 tbsp hemp seeds.

  2. 02

    Add 0

    Add 0.75 cup plain Greek yogurt, 0.25 cup unsweetened almond milk, 0.5 scoop vanilla whey protein powder, and 0.25 tsp ground cinnamon to the jar.

  3. 03

    Stir the mixture thoroughly using a spoon…

    Stir the mixture thoroughly using a spoon until all protein powder is fully dissolved and no dry spots remain.

  4. 04

    Cover the jar tightly with a lid…

    Cover the jar tightly with a lid and place it in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ours, or overnight.

  5. 05

    Remove from the refrigerator

    Remove from the refrigerator, give the oats a quick stir, and top with 0.25 cup fresh blueberries just before serving.
